The biggest cricket extravaganza ICC Cricket World Cup 2015 will kick-start on February 14. Star Sports will broadcast the matches in six languages and as part for their marketing blitz around the World Cup, Star has released series of TVC films as part of its 'Won't Give It Back' campaign to evoke the passion among fans. One of the recent TVCs is targeted specifically on the India vs Pakistan match on February 15, 2014.

The TVC has been conceptualised by the internal team of Star Sports and it tries to capture the essence that India versus Pakistan match is the biggest game in the cricket calendar. Also, according to statistics, India holds the bragging rights: India and Pakistan have played against each other in the World Cup five times and India has come out victorious each time.

According to a Star spokesperson, “The India Pakistan game launch campaign has seen intense interest and conversations online attracting over 2.3 million views in 48 hours, reflecting an unprecedented anticipation and hype over the big game.”

The TVC shows a young Pakistan cricket fan, sporting the team colours, waiting to celebrate the victory over India in the World Cup since 1992. The wait has been so long that he now has a son, who also repeats his father's routine to no avail as India eventually overcome them. The comic element of the film revolves around the fans' routine of getting the crackers out for celebration in every edition of World Cup when India and Pakistan play, in anticipation of their win, but only to shelf them back again in disappointment.
